The main production areas of pine wood worldwide
Global pine timber hubs concentrate in Northern Hemisphere:
1. Nordic: Swedish/Finnish Scots Pine (35% global export) with fine grain
2. Russia: Siberian Red Pine reserves exceed 120 million m³ annual yield
3. North America: Fast-growing Southern Yellow Pine dominates plantations
4. Oceania: New Zealand Radiata Pine reaches harvest in 25-30 years
China produces Masson Pine & Mongolian Pine in northeast/southwest

Core Manufacturing Steps
1. Log Prep: Cross-cutting (2.6m logs), debarking, steam conditioning (60-80℃)
2. Peeling & Drying: Rotary cutting (0.1-3.5mm veneer), roller drying to 8-12% MC
3. Gluing & Layup: Double-side glue spreading (120±5g/㎡), cross-grain assembly
4. Pre-pressing: Cold pressing (0.8-1.2MPa) to eliminate air pockets
5. Hot Pressing: Multi-stage pressure (6→4→2MPa), 140-160℃ for 30-90 sec/layer
6. Trimming & Sanding: Precision edging (±0.5mm), thickness sanding (Ra≤3.2μm)
7. Grading & Packing: Graded per GB/T 9846/EN 314-2, moisture-proof wrapping

Characteristics and Advantages of Pine Plywood
Performance Superiority:
✦ High Strength/Weight: MOR≥35MPa (28% higher than poplar plywood)
✦ Dimensional Stability: Thickness swelling ≤8% (3hr boiling test)
✦ Shock Absorption: Impact toughness 60kJ/m² for logistics packaging
Processing Advantages:
✓ Painting Adhesion: Natural resin enables Grade 0 cross-cut test
✓ Mold Resistance: Terpineol inhibits fungal growth (ASTM D3273 compliant)
✓ Carbon Sequestration: Stores 280kg-CO₂/m³ (FSC certified)
Unique Value:
▶ Reusable 20+ times as concrete formwork (vs. 8-10 for standard plywood)
▶ Thermal conductivity 0.12W/(m·K) - 40% better than OSB
